snowed inCarrie Drummond is excited to spend a fun, relaxing weekend at a mountain cabin with her friends–a last hurrah before they all graduate college in a few months. But when the power goes out and the only other person to make it through the snowstorm is the one man in the world she hates, she thinks the weekend is ruined.

But her so-called enemy has other plans.

Bryan Grant always ends up with his foot in his mouth around Carrie, and he’s determined not to let their night alone go to waste. But will the uptight, lawyer-in-training be able to convince the paint-stained artist to give him a shot?

Snowed In is a contemporary erotic romance novelette. It is not intended for younger readers due to mature content.

Reviewer’s Thoughts

A perfect example of what a novella should be, Snowed In is intense, passionate and steamy!  Carrie and Bryan, the heroine and hero, have electrifying chemistry, which just burns off of the pages.  It’s a very quick read, but one that will leave you breathless with a smile on your face.
